Cleveland Cavaliers vs. Orlando Magic Preview
In a hotly anticipated matchup on Saturday evening, the Cleveland Cavaliers (26-20) will take to the court against the Orlando Magic (23-20) in Orlando, Florida. The game is set to tip off at 7 p.m. EST, with current betting odds from BetMGM showing the Magic favored by one point and an over/under total set at 228 points.
Team Performance and Standings
Cleveland arrives in Orlando on a high note, boasting a three-game winning streak on the road. This recent success has helped them secure the fifth spot in the Eastern Conference, while their opponents, the Magic, are currently positioned seventh. The Cavaliers have performed commendably against Eastern Conference foes, with a record of 17 wins to 13 losses.
Orlando, balancing their season thus far with a 15-15 record in conference play, excels in fast-break opportunities, ranking eighth in the league with an average of 16.6 points generated from such plays. Franz Wagner is a key contributor in this area, accounting for an impressive 3.9 points per game from fast breaks. However, the Magic will be without Wagner for this game due to an ankle injury, alongside Colin Castleton and Jalen Suggs, who is day-to-day with a knee issue.
Scoring Capabilities
On the other hand, Cleveland’s scoring capabilities are highlighted by their impressive average of 119.2 points per game on a shooting accuracy of 46.9%. They also lead in three-pointers, averaging 14.7 made shots from beyond the arc, while the Magic allow 12.0 three-pointers per game. The Cavaliers’ Donovan Mitchell stands out on the team, scoring an average of 29.0 points along with 4.8 rebounds per game.
Recent Form and Injuries
When comparing recent forms, the Magic have an even 5-5 record across their last ten games, scoring an average of 112 points, while allowing their opponents to score 116.3 points. The Cavaliers, however, bring a slight edge with a record of 6-4 in their last ten outings, scoring 118.1 points and shooting 48.4% from the field.
Notably, Cleveland will miss the contributions of Max Strus, Darius Garland, and Sam Merrill due to injuries, further complicating their strategy as they pursue their fourth consecutive win on the road.
